首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 0 毫秒
1.
TCP/IP及互联网技术在工业领域得到广泛应用,然而大量工业现场设备尚不具备网络接口,主要通过串行口进行通讯,因而无法直接连接到Internet。笔者设计了一种基于ARM处理器的嵌入式以太网接口系统,用来解决这些传统设备与现今的网络设备之间的互联问题。  相似文献   

2.
μC/OS-Ⅱ是专门为嵌入式应用而设计的实时操作系统,移植难度主要体现在所采用的编译器的不同.该文着重介绍了μC/OS-Ⅱ在嵌入式ARM微处理器上的移植方法和过程.采用自由软件Linux下C语言编译器ann-elf-gcc作为开发工具来编译嵌入式操作系统μC/OS-Ⅱ,并利用开源软件SkyEye进行测试,证明其有效性.  相似文献   

3.
卢琨  童学容  冯鑫 《科技信息》2013,(6):116-117,112
如今针对嵌入式GUI系统的研究大多集中在理论研究和应用开发上,实现一个可以工作并表现出色的嵌入式GUI系统对于开发者来说并不是件容易的事情。本文针对MiniGUI的可移植性分析,通过修改驱动接口函数以及POSIX线程库,最终实现MiniGUI基于μC/OS-Ⅱ的运行并在SmartARM2400实现了图形显示的支持。所述的移植方法不仅可以应用于工业嵌入式仪器仪表中,也可以为工业嵌入式控制系统以及其他通信终端的应用和开发提供新的可能。  相似文献   

4.
详细阐述了嵌入式网络接入系统的硬件结构、嵌入式实时操作系统μC/OS-II在51微处理器P87C52上的移植过程和系统软件设计方法.该系统一方面实现了通过TCP/IP网络协议接入Internet;另一方面提供了RS232与I2C等通信功能.这样,每个本地设备都可以通过此系统与Internet相连,而Internet中的其他主机也可以通过此系统对本地的各种设备进行控制,并给出了系统的测试结果.  相似文献   

5.
随着嵌入式系统硬件技术和软件技术的发展,把实时嵌入式操作系统移植到微处理器上已经成为了多媒体系统发展的趋势和迫切需要,ARM体系结构和μC/OS-Ⅱ因它们各自的优势已经成为了嵌入式系统应用的研究热点。TI DM270是ARM体系架构下的基于SOC的数字媒体处理器。将抢先式、多任务、实时嵌入式操作系统μC/OS-Ⅱ移植到TI DM270微处理器上,其移植原理和移植过程具有重要的意义和广泛的借鉴价值。研发中采用的开发工具为CCS并在源代码调试器上通过功能测试。  相似文献   

6.
提出了一种基于ARM和μC/OS-Ⅱ的车载GPS/GPRS移动终端的设计方案.该方案采用嵌入式系统设计思想,以S3C44B0X处理器为硬件平台,引入基于优先级的抢占式实时多任务嵌入式操作系统μC/OS-Ⅱ.文中描述了车辆监控系统的原理和车载终端的主要功能,给出了车载终端的硬件和软件设计,介绍了μC/OS-Ⅱ在系统中的应用.该终端实时性好,数据传输费用低,软硬件易升级.  相似文献   

7.
刘悦 《科技信息》2011,(21):40-40,25
本文完成的μC/OS-Ⅱ操作系统的移植是基于S3C2410开发板,概要介绍μC/OS-Ⅱ操作系统,然后研究和编写了三个移植文件,最后给出应用程序的测试。结果表明,移植在S3C2410上的μC/OS-Ⅱ操作系统可以稳定的运行。  相似文献   

8.
9.
生物酶催化温度场实时测量系统,需要高速、同步的采集反应器皿底部的多点温度,为了满足系统高速同步多点测量的需求,使用ATmega128作为系统的MCU,并在其上嵌入了实时操作系统μC/OS-Ⅱ,以提高系统的实时性和稳定性,降低了单片机单任务顺序执行方式所常有的死机现象.在温度场测量方面,将DS18B20温度传感器常用的串行操作改为并行操作,通过软件编程实现了同时读取多路温度数据的目的,使得读取一路温度数据的时间与读取多路温度数据的时间几乎相同,达到了高速测量的要求,很大程度上提高了温度采集的效率,满足了生物酶催化反应分析仪的需求.  相似文献   

10.
基于μC/OS-Ⅱ的多任务工业以太网测控节点设计   总被引:1,自引:1,他引:0  
文章介绍了一种基于单片机ADμC834和以太网控制芯片RTL8019AS的测控节点的硬件架构,该节点包含模拟量输入、开关量输出和越限报警等功能模块.本节点以嵌入式μC/OS-Ⅱ为操作系统,以uIP为以太网协议栈,节点在多任务环境和以太网通信的支持下可顺利地执行模拟量采集、控制量输出、以太网通讯和越限报警等任务.  相似文献   

11.
分析了μC/OS-Ⅱ实时内核在AT89S52型单片机上的移植步骤及过程,对移植中的关键问题做了深入探讨,并编写了测试案例进行功能性测试.测试结果表明,μC/OS-Ⅱ内核移植成功,在该平台的基础上可以进一步开发系统功能.  相似文献   

12.
简要介绍μC/OS-Ⅱ的组成和工作原理,详细分析移植的环境和条件,明确指出移植中的关键问题,即堆栈的建立、释放和恢复问题。以51单片机系统为例,提出了相应的解决办法,并对编制的程序代码进行了说明。通过在8031单片机系统中建立工作堆栈、仿真堆栈、任务堆栈及其附加段,修改μC/OS-Ⅱ中与移植有关的程序文件,实现了μC/OS-Ⅱ在单片机系统中的移植。相关实验测试进一步证实了本移植思想。文章深入讨论部分为嵌入式操作系统μC/OS-Ⅱ的复杂应用提供了指导。  相似文献   

13.
针对传统移植不涉及固件库的弊端,以STM32F103RB处理器为例,提出了适合习惯于固件库开发人员的移植μC/OS-Ⅱ的新方法。详细说明了该移植方法的主要步骤,并分析了移植的关键函数,既兼顾了传统移植深入底层函数的分析过程,又兼顾了从Micrium官方网站下载的移植程序包不适合直接使用的问题。提出的移植新方法非常符合嵌入式系统软件开发的潮流。  相似文献   

14.
介绍了实时操作系统μC/OS-Ⅱ在C8051F060上的移植,详细介绍了移植的过程,所用到的方法具有一般意义,对于向其他平台的移植具有参考价值μC/OS-Ⅱ是一个优秀的嵌入式实时操作系统,对于理解其他嵌入式操作系统有很大的帮助,在此基础上有利于提高应用程序的开发效率,提高稳定性.  相似文献   

15.
针对煤矿井下轨道运输自动信号系统中复杂的功能要求,以32位ARM微处理器LPC2119为硬件平台,将嵌入式实时操作系统μC/OS-Ⅱ移植到自动信号系统中.阐述了自动信号系统的组成,硬件设计以及用户任务的设计,实验结果表明,该系统具有较好的实时性和可靠性.  相似文献   

16.
结合ARM处理器AT91M55800A与嵌入式实时操作系统μC/OS-Ⅱ的特点,重点分析μC/OS-Ⅱ在AT91M55800A上的移植技术,对移植工作中的重点难点做了详细分析,并介绍了ARM汇编程序在移植过程中的设计技巧。  相似文献   

17.
提出了一种全新的多任务优先级调度算法,它保留了现有调度算法的时间确定性和实时性的优点,还使其空间复杂度与支持的任务数无关. 系统最多支持的任务数不仅可以轻松地从现有的64个增加到256个,根据实际需要还可以更多.  相似文献   

18.
给出了一种通过使用实时操作系统μC/OS-Ⅱ的TCB扩展指针部分,在其上实现多线程程序的方法,此方法对系统实时性的影响在一定程度上是可以忽略的,并对其在实际应用中的相关问题进行了探讨。  相似文献   

19.
首先分析实时操作系统μC/OS-Ⅱ的系统结构和DSP56F807硬件平台特性,其次编写与硬件相关的代码,μC/OS-Ⅱ实时内核移植到DSP56F807上,并进行移植后的测试,最后提出一些在μC/OS-Ⅱ移植过程中的问题。  相似文献   

20.
基于μC/OS-Ⅱ的嵌入式校园导航系统的设计与实现   总被引:1,自引:0,他引:1  
叙述了在基于ARM技术的MC9328MXl龙珠处理器上,移殖μC/OS-Ⅱ操作系统.用C语言及汇编语言编程,在ARM嵌入式开发平台上实现校园导航系统的过程。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号